I suspect we're going to end up with a RX300 SE-L though. We've looked at them before and since we purchased a Honda CR-V for my wife in March, I'm beginning to think I made a mistake. It's a lovely car - SE Exec with leather etc, but the engine just isn't that nice. It's only a four cylinder, and revs at 3750 rpm at 80mph and just sounds toooooo stressed.
We've just come back from a week in the lake district and the CRV is fantastic once you get there - just crap compared to my IS200 on the motorway. However, the IS200 just doesn't go where the CRV can when you get there!
So, I reckon, once the CRV is 3 years old (my IS will be four) we'll sell the IS and the CRV and buy and RX300 SEL for the motorway and lake district work - and then I can treat myself to a fun car.... either a 350 if I can afford the difference between 23k and the 27.5k. Otherwise, it might just be an Elise... :)
Don't let the Nissan badge put you off buying a 350Z - I'm going to put my neck on the line here and say that the build quality of the 350Z is far superior to that of my IS200 I used to have.
With regard to the CR-V, you hit the nail on the head, saying it's a 4-pot so you can't expect it to rumble along like a straight 6, but it's by far the most refined of the soft-roaders out there. It could do with a sixth gear though!
